Problem 1: A truck pulls a box up a ramp at a constant given constant acceleration A as shown above with an ideal rope. The angle of the ramp is given as 0. The wheels of the truck pull the truck up with no slipping and no sliding. The box is greased on the bottom surface so that there is a given coefficient of sliding friction between the box and the ramp of jz. The mass of the truck is given as rn; and the mass of the box is given as mg. a) Draw a careful Free Body Diagram for both the truck and the box. Include a proper coordi- nate system and be sure to indicate every force on each body. Make very sure you have each force clearly and properly labeled. At this time we expect all students use the format and notation given in this class for every FBD. b) In terms of given parameters A, mm, rm, j1 and @, determine the magnitude of each and every force on both the truck and the box. Note: thee are four forces on each. Be sure you find all eight forces and express your answers in terms of the given parameters
